Just to know your feedback on the S/N determination:

- With nmrDraw, we get a fairly accurate determination of S/N on 2D
spectrum (by determining the noise with SDev and peak heigh). However, I
did not succeed with a 3D spectrum (it seems that peak picking is only
done in the first plane. May be I do a mishandling).

- With sparky It is posible to obtain a S/N estimation (LT) but it is a
pretty black box and I do not like this.

For plans coming from nD (n>2) what are the method(s) you use and what
is the estimated accuracy of the method(s) ?
